- Tell_al-Ghir abstract "Tal Agher (Arabic: تل أغر) is a Syrian village located in Sabburah Nahiyah in Al-Salamiyah District, Hama. According to the Syria Central Bureau of Statistics (CBS), Tal Agher had a population of 679 in the 2004 census.".
